本文目录导读:
在当今数字化时代,人们越来越依赖互联网获取信息、娱乐和社交资源,为了满足不同人群的需求,许多开发者开始着手创建个性化的导航网站,这些网站不仅能够帮助用户快速定位所需内容,还能提升用户体验,增强网站的互动性和吸引力。
图片来源于网络,如有侵权联系删除
随着互联网技术的飞速发展,各种类型的网站如雨后春笋般涌现出来,面对琳琅满目的选项,用户往往感到无从下手,一款集成了各类热门网站、应用和服务于一身的定制化导航网站应运而生,它为用户提供了一个便捷、高效的上网入口。
自定义导航网站的优势
精简版面设计
传统的搜索引擎虽然功能强大,但界面复杂且难以找到特定信息,而自定义导航网站通过简洁明了的设计理念,将常用网站和应用分类展示在首页上,让用户一目了然地找到自己需要的链接。
举例:
- 新闻资讯:聚合各大主流媒体的最新动态,便于用户随时了解国内外重大事件;
- 视频播放:集成优酷、爱奇艺等知名视频平台,满足用户的观影需求;
- 购物商城:收录淘宝、京东等电商平台,方便用户在线购物。
高效搜索功能
除了直接访问热门网站外,自定义导航网站还提供了强大的搜索功能,用户只需输入关键词即可迅速检索到相关结果,省去了逐个浏览的时间成本。
例子:
- 智能推荐:根据用户的历史记录和行为偏好进行个性化推荐,提高查找效率;
- 多语种支持:适应全球用户的需求,实现跨语言的顺畅交流。
定制化设置
考虑到不同用户的喜好和使用习惯各不相同,自定义导航网站允许用户根据自己的需求调整页面布局、颜色主题以及添加或删除某些模块。
实例:
- 快捷键操作:设定常用的网站或功能的快捷键,一键直达目标页面;
- 桌面widget:将常用工具集成到电脑桌面,无需打开浏览器也能轻松使用。
安全防护措施
在网络环境中,信息安全尤为重要,自定义导航网站通常会采取一系列安全策略来保护用户的隐私和数据安全。
措施:
- HTTPS加密传输:确保数据在网络上传递时的安全性;
- 防钓鱼攻击:识别并拦截可疑网址,防止用户误入陷阱;
- 定期更新病毒库:及时响应新出现的恶意软件威胁。
开发流程与关键技术
前端技术栈
前端是构建自定义导航网站的重要组成部分,目前流行的前端框架有React、Vue.js等,它们各自拥有独特的优势和适用场景。
选择理由:
- React因其组件化和声明式编程方式受到广泛喜爱,适用于大型应用的构建;
- Vue.js则以其简洁易用的特性赢得了众多中小型项目的青睐。
后端服务搭建
后端负责处理业务逻辑和数据交互,常见的后端技术包括Node.js、Django等。
图片来源于网络,如有侵权联系删除
应用案例:
- Node.js + Express组合用于快速开发和部署RESTful API接口;
- Python + Django框架擅长于企业级应用程序的开发和维护。
数据库管理
数据库的选择取决于存储需求和性能要求,MySQL、MongoDB等关系型和非关系型数据库各有千秋。
具体选择:
- 对于结构化数据的存储和管理,MySQL无疑是最佳选择;
- 如果需要灵活的数据结构和大规模数据处理能力,MongoDB则是更好的选择。
云服务器部署
云服务器提供了弹性计算资源和可扩展性强的优势,非常适合初创企业和个人开发者。
部署步骤:
- 注册并购买合适的云服务提供商的服务计划;
- 安装必要的操作系统和环境变量;
- 配置网络安全规则和负载均衡器以提高可用性。
未来发展趋势
随着5G网络的普及和物联网技术的发展,自定义导航网站将会迎来更多机遇和挑战。
跨设备兼容性
用户可能会在不同的终端设备上进行上网活动(如手机、平板电脑、智能电视等),自定义导航网站需要具备良好的跨设备兼容性,以确保在不同平台上都能获得一致的体验。
实现:
- 使用响应式网页设计技术(RWD)使网站自适应各种屏幕尺寸;
- 支持移动端的触摸操作手势。
语音交互技术
随着语音识别技术的进步,越来越多的用户倾向于通过语音指令来控制设备和查询信息,自定义导航网站可以引入语音交互功能,让用户更加便捷地进行操作。
应用实例:
- 语音搜索:说出想要找的内容,系统自动完成搜索过程;
- 语音命令:下达指令如“打开某个网站”,无需手动点击即可执行。
人工智能应用
利用机器学习和自然语言处理等技术,自定义导航网站可以实现更智能的用户服务和个性化推荐。
标签: #自定义导航网站 源码
评论列表